1. A Soldier's Commitment Service, Honor, Duty Marker
Inscription. Commitments are made by all soldiers as they perform their duties to protect our lives and freedoms from foreign aggressors.

Soldiers oath (Oath of Enlistment)
"I_____, do solemnly swear (or affirm) that I will support and defend the Constitution of the United States against all enemies, foreign and domestic; that I will bear true faith and allegiance to the same; and that I will obey the orders of the President of the United States and the orders of the officers appointed over me, according to regulations and the Uniform Code of Military Justice. So help me God."

Soldiers Creed
• I am an American Soldier.
• I am a Warrior and a member of a team.
• I serve the people of the United States and live the Army Values.
• I will always place the mission first.
• I will never accept defeat.
• I will never quit.
• I will never leave a fallen comrade.
• I am disciplined, physically and mentally tough, trained, and proficient in my warrior tasks and drills.
• I always maintain my arms, my equipment, and myself.
• I am an expert and I am a professional.
• I stand ready to deploy, engage, and destroy the enemies of the United States of America in close combat.
• I am a guardian of freedom and the American way of life.
• I am an American Soldier. (Marker Number M6.)
